Excellent episode as always, but instead of writing about what I liked this time, I'm going to write about what I'd like to see.

In a nutshell, I think the writers have toned down the relationship between Castle and Beckett to an almost non-existent level, and are in danger of turning "Castle" into just another buddy cop show.  Now don't get me wrong:  "Castle" is still an excellent show, and nothing's going to tear me away from the TV on Monday nights whether or not the relationship ever really develops, but the thing I like the most about this show is the same thing I loved about X-Files, Farscape, Moonlighting, and even Who's the Boss (good God that's a name I haven't heard in a while)…the romantic relationship aspect.

Over the past few episodes, there has been a remarkable lack of flirting going on between the two.  There have been moments of course, but for the most part Castle gives Beckett an opening, and all she does is roll her eyes or shake her head.  I'd love to see more moments like the one between them where Castle notices she smells like cherries, or when she goes home to read his book.  A single scene like these can make an entire episode, if not a season, and by focusing more on the humor, the witty one-liners, and the crime of the week, and less on the budding relationship, the writers are in danger of having Castle enter the "friend zone".  I'm afraid that when it comes time for the story to actually bring them together in a romantic fashion it's not going to feel right because the groundwork hasn't been properly laid out.

Truthfully, what I think the show needs is a hackneyed old "we're stuck with each other in an elevator that we can't get out of and we have no choice but to talk about things that actually mean something instead of one-upping each other" episode to turn up the heat a bit.  I like slow builds, but this is almost the halfway point of season two.  Something needs to happen pretty soon.

Anyway, that's my opinion.  As for this episode, everyone did a phenomenal job…and I'd love to see Alexis become a permanent volunteer around the police station.  She obviously enjoyed the work, and finding ways to bring her into the mix so she can play go-between with Castle and Beckett should be a priority for the writers.  In fact, taking this episode together with last week's episode, I'm wondering if Alexis isn't looking ahead to when she'll be moving away to college…and is actually trying to set her father up with Beckett so she won't have to worry about him when she leaves.  For Beckett's part, she's probably looking at Alexis and thinking "a man that could raise such an extrordinary daughter can't be the buffoon he makes himself out to be.  These waters are deeper than I thought."

Moonie pie said:the last thing I remember was when they had found a house on Long Island & were thinking it might be lady # 3


Short version:

Lady #3 turned out to be the fiancee, and she had a false identity too.

So: Dead guy spied on chem firm for recycle method. Boss found out and hired fiancee to get him off his track with false info. Dead guy found out that chem firm was lying and polluting. Fiancee had found pictures (proof of pollution) when visiting wife, Castle found them shredded. But fiancee had alibi. Boss had not, and they found gun in trash by his house.

Turns out dead guy was "old fashioned" and didn't sleep with fiancee, staying true to wife and trying to save environment – wife comforted in her grief.

Alexis found owner of picture book, Beckett said: "I'm very impressed you closed this case." (with Caslte as witness). Castle very proud.
